Title: Mechanical Contractor Bond Alternate Title: Mechanical Specialist Bond Description: Minn. Stat. 326B.197 needs anyone who installs gas piping, heating, ventilation, cooling, cooling, fuel burning or refrigeration (G/HVACR) devices to post a $25,000 bond and file with the Minnesota Department of Labor and Industry (DLI), Building Codes and Licensing Division (CCLD).

In addition to filing a bond, mechanical contractors go through local licensing requirements. Minnesota's Book shopoffers mechanical codes, including: Minnesota State Mechanical Code (Minn. Guidelines 1346) International Mechanical Code International Fuel Gas Code Standard for Ventilation Control and Fire Security of Commercial Cooking Operations (NFPA 96) Minnesota State Mechanical, Fuel Gas and Pipes Code The Minnesota State Building Regulations is the requirement for building statewide, however, the code is implemented by specific cities and townships This chapter of the state building regulations governs the setup and upkeep of heating, aerating, cooling, and refrigeration systems or so-called "HVAC" systems.
